This release reworks how the warehouse pick-list optimizer batches orders across zones. Previously, the solver treated each aisle independently, which produced inefficient crossover routes in the Delverton fulfillment center. The new cost model weighs cart capacity and walking distance together, cutting average route length by roughly 11% in replay tests. New team members should note that the zone-weight config now lives in the optimizer service, not the legacy YAML. All questions about this release go to the maintainer:

named custodian: Brivan Eliath Quenox Frador

Subject: token refresh cut-over

Fix for the Vantrel session-token refresh bug is live. Old path refreshed on expiry; new path refreshes at 80% TTL with jitter. Cut-over done behind a kill switch, removed after 24h clean. No auth errors since. Review the diff against the grace-period handling, that's the risky bit. The service now boots with the following configuration values.

service settings:
[casax]
port = 6379
team = rusir
host = casax.zemvarhq.corp
region = outer-4
access_code = ac_9808ce
timeout_ms = 1500

### Changelog — v4.0 defaults

Heads up, future maintainers: Fabricant (our test-data factory) now seeds deterministic IDs by default instead of random ones. Flaky snapshot tests were driving everyone up the wall, so we flipped it. You can still opt into random mode per-factory. Batch sizes and locale defaults changed too. The new out-of-the-box defaults are as follows.

settings of bafof-fajog:
[aldix]
port = 9300
region = north-3
host = aldix.kelvilabs.example
team = istath
timeout_ms = 1500
retries = 8